IDMODELING AND NOBEL SYSTEMS PARTNER TO LEVERAGE GIS AND HYDRAULIC MODELING SERVICES
IDModeling and Nobel System’s common work approach and client relationships have built a track record
of quality and trust that is the basis for this Partnership moving forward. Collective efforts will champion
projects in the Northeast and Northwest specifically, as these markets have demonstrated significant need for
utility management, planning, and replacement.
IDModeling has secured a niche-market among engineering consultants and water/wastewater utilities as the
only service-based, hydraulic modeling specialty company in the United States. IDModeling targets stand-alone
hydraulic model projects or hydraulic modeling for Water/Sewer/Recycled Water System Master Plans while
implementing model conversions, software evaluations, value engineering, and training services nationwide.
As Geographic Information Systems (GIS) grows prevalent in the water/wastewater industries, Nobel Systems had
earned a strong reputation for efficient, systematic, and award-winning data conversion services. These services,
complemented by the implementation of GeoViewer Online
as an easy-to-use, GIS browser with utility-specific analysis tools has garnered Nobel's services as a
“fixed-asset” in today’s utility operations.

About Nobel Systems
Nobel Systems is a privately held corporation that specializes in GIS conversion [conversion of paper maps into high quality
geographic information system (GIS)], GIS Data Viewing and Hosting [with the Geoviewer application, which allows for the
viewing and querying of the GIS database], and GIS Consulting [providing expert assistance and solutions regarding GIS projects
and issues]. Nobel Systems is headquartered in San Bernardino, CA, with branch offices in Williamstown, NJ, Reno/Sparks, NV,
and San Marcos, CA. For more information, visit www.nobel-systems.com.
